Rashtriya Khanij Puraskar 2022: All You Need to Know

Rashtriya Khanij Puraskar 2022

The Rashtriya Khanij is introduced by the Union Ministry of Mines. It is a national award to promote and facilitate mining all over the country. The Rashtriya Khanij Puraskar 2022 is introduced to encourage the states that take the initiative in the exploration, auction, and operationalization of mineral blocks.

There are three categories of minerals to which the Rashtriya Khanij Puraskar will be awarded. The awards for the year 2018-2020 and 2020-2021 have been given during the 6th National Conclave on Mines & Minerals, which was held on 12th July 2022. A total of ₹18 crores was awarded as prize money to different states.

Gujarat received the 1st prize in Rashtriya Khanij Puraskar for the auction of Minor Minerals from Hon’ble Home Minister Shri Amit Shah.

Rashtriya Khanij Puraskar 2022: Prize Money

  1. First Position- Rs 3 crore
  2. Second Position – Rs 2 crore
  3. Third Position – Rs 1 crore

Rashtriya Khanij Puraskar 2022: Incentives for States for Mineral Auction

The government has decided to provide incentives to the states to encourage them to auction mineral blocks. The incentives are given below.

  • The states where potential mineral blocks are available for auction will be given Rs 20 lakh.
  • The states will be given Rs 20 lakh for each successful auction of the mineral block.
  • For conducting an auction subjected to a maximum of Rs 5 lakh for each block that was put up for auction but could not be successfully auctioned will be given reimbursement of 50% of the Transaction Advisor fee.
  • A total of Rs 21.02 crore has been released by the center for the states in the above categories during the 6th National Conclave on Mines & Minerals.

Rashtriya Khanij Puraskar 2022: 6th National Conclave on Mines & Minerals

The 6th National Conclave on Mines & Minerals was organized by the Ministry of Mines on 12th July 2022 in New Delhi. The event was facilitated by the union home minister Shri. Amit Shah as Chief Guest. The Union Minister of Mines, Coal, and Parliamentary Affairs Shri Prahlad Joshi inaugurated the one-day conclave.
